  A 1.250 g sample of cheese was subjected to a Kjeldahl analysis to determine the amount of protein. The sample was digested, the nitrogen is oxidized to NH₄⁺, and was then converted to NH₃ with NaOH, and distilled into a collection flask containing 50.00 mL of 0.1050 M HCl. The excess HCl is back titrated with 0.1175 M NaOH, this required 21.65 mL to reach the bromothymol blue end point. Report the %N of the cheese sample.

Hydrogen is prepared commercially by the reaction of methane and water vapor at elevated temperatures.

CH4 (g) + H2O (g) ⇌ H2 (g) + CO (g)

What is the equilibrium constant for the reaction if a mixture at equilibrium contains gases with the following concentrations, at a temperature of 760 °C?

CH4 = 0.126 M

H2O = 0.242 M

CO = 0.126 M

H2 = 1.15 M
